Transaction ccf6924189994bfb209ac9c143432108be306254c50d0a1abc0cae2335240944
1 Input
1 Output
-
ccf6924189994bfb209ac9c143432108be306254c50d0a1abc0cae2335240944:0
- value
- 408900
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e563f8105aa2fb6a8a3e93b3af91f97d8ee4a69
- address
- bc1qdetrlqg94ghmd29rayan47gljlvwujnf50aeju